Ingredients:
- 3 lbs Swanson Family Farm grass-finished beef chuck roast
- 2 tbsp olive oil
- Salt and black pepper (to taste)
- 1 large onion, chopped
- 4 carrots, cut into chunks
- 4 medium potatoes, quartered
- 3 garlic cloves, minced
- 2 cups beef broth
- 1 cup red wine (optional)
- 2 tbsp Worcestershire sauce
- 1 tsp dried thyme
- 1 tsp rosemary
Instructions:
- Prepare the Roast: Pat the beef chuck roast dry with paper towels. Season generously with salt and pepper on all sides.
- Sear the Meat: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Sear the roast on all sides until browned, about 4 minutes per side. Transfer to a slow cooker.
- Add Vegetables: Place the chopped onion, carrots, and potatoes around the roast in the slow cooker.
- Create the Sauce: In a small bowl, mix beef broth, red wine (if using), Worcestershire sauce, garlic, thyme, and rosemary. Pour this mixture over the roast and vegetables.
- Cook: Cover and cook on low for 8–10 hours, or until the beef is fork-tender.
- Serve: Remove the roast and vegetables from the slow cooker. Use the juices to make a quick gravy, or serve as is. Enjoy with warm biscuits or cornbread for a truly Southern experience.
